TRAINS
Victoria has a fast, frequent and user-friendly train system. Flinders Street Station is the hub of Melbourne’s train system and the City Loop has five stations servicing the central business district: Southern Cross, Flagstaff, Melbourne Central, Parliament and Flinders Street.
Connex provides train services across the metropolitan area running from around 5am (7am Sunday) until close to midnight seven days a week. Later services also operate out of the city on Friday and Saturday nights.
